MISSING ACK von HM-LC-Sw1PBU-FM

Begonnen von linuxer, 11 Februar 2018, 16:39:06

Vorheriges Thema - Nächstes Thema

linuxer

Hallo,
Hi,

ich versuche gerade mein FHEM auf dem Raspberry in der Version 5.8 mit oben genannten Homematice Device zu pairen.
Bis dato hatte ich 2 Schalter dieser Art erfolgreich pairen können. Leider ist mir ein pairen über den normalen Weg nicht möglich, es wurde leider nichts gefunden, auch wurde der Schalter mehrmals zurück gesetzt. Wenn ich den Schalter über die Serial paire, ist dieser zwar sichtbar, aber leider nicht steuerbar. Anbei der List des Gerätes:


ein LIST bringt folgendes:

Internals:
   DEF        44980C
   IODev      CUL_0
   NAME       HM_44980C
   NOTIFYDEV  global
   NR         62
   NTFY_ORDER 50-HM_44980C
   STATE      MISSING ACK
   TYPE       CUL_HM
   protCmdDel 12
   protResnd  9 last_at:2018-02-11 16:26:40
   protResndFail 3 last_at:2018-02-11 16:26:45
   protSnd    3 last_at:2018-02-11 16:26:26
   protState  CMDs_done_Errors:1
   READINGS:
     2018-02-11 16:01:20   D-firmware      2.8
     2018-02-11 16:01:20   D-serialNr      NEQ0138072
     2018-02-11 16:24:02   RegL_00.       
     2018-02-11 16:18:40   deviceMsg       off (to broadcast)
     2018-02-11 16:18:40   level           0
     2018-02-11 16:18:40   pct             0
     2018-02-11 16:18:40   powerOn         2018-02-11 16:18:40
     2018-02-11 16:18:40   recentStateType info
     2018-02-11 16:26:45   state           MISSING ACK
     2018-02-11 16:18:40   timedOn         off
   helper:
     HM_CMDNR   21
     cSnd       11F1103444980C0201C80000,11F1103444980C0201C80000
     dlvl       C8
     dlvlCmd    ++A011F1103444980C0201C80000
     mId        0069
     regLst     ,0,1,3p
     rxType     1
     expert:
       def        1
       det        0
       raw        1
       tpl        0
     io:
       newChn     +44980C,00,00,00
       prefIO     
       rxt        0
       vccu       
       p:
         44980C
         00
         00
         00
     mRssi:
       mNo       
     prt:
       bErr       0
       sProc      0
     q:
       qReqConf   00
       qReqStat   00
     role:
       chn        1
       dev        1
       prs        1
Attributes:
   IODev      CUL_0
   autoReadReg 4_reqStatus
   expert     2_raw
   firmware   2.8
   model      HM-LC-Sw1PBU-FM
   room       CUL_HM
   serialNr   NEQ0138072
   subType    switch
   webCmd     statusRequest:toggle:on:off

Any Ideas ?

Vielen Dank im Voraus.

Gruß
Marco


Amenophis86

Hallo linuxer und willkommen im Forum,

zum einen bitte ich dich Codetags (das #-Symbol über den Smilies) zu nutzen. Zum zweiten hat die Version von CUL_HM.pm von heute einen Fehler, wenn ich es richtig gesehen habe. Daher ist die Frage von wann dein FHEM ist und ob es daran liegen kann. Kenne aber den Fehler nicht genau, da ich mich nicht tiefer eingelesen habe.Musste mal im Homematic Unterforum schauen.
Aktuell dabei unser neues Haus mit KNX am einrichten. Im nächsten Schritt dann KNX mit FHEM verbinden. Allein zwei Dinge sind dabei selten: Zeit und Geld...

Otto123

Hi,

also wenn es nicht das aktuelle Update Problem ist.
Der Schalter ist noch nicht gepairt, es fehlen die entsprechenden Readings. -> https://wiki.fhem.de/wiki/HomeMatic_Devices_pairen
Du hast einen CUL, der ist suboptimal als HM IO. -> https://wiki.fhem.de/wiki/HomeMatic#FHEM_als_Zentrale
Verwende bitte HMINfo configCheck zur Fehlersuche. -> https://wiki.fhem.de/wiki/HomeMatic_HMInfo

Gruß Otto
Viele Grüße aus Leipzig  ⇉  nächster Stammtisch an der Lindennaundorfer Mühle
RaspberryPi B B+ B2 B3 B3+ ZeroW,HMLAN,HMUART,Homematic,Fritz!Box 7590,WRT3200ACS-OpenWrt,Sonos,VU+,Arduino nano,ESP8266,MQTT,Zigbee,deconz

linuxer

Hi Otto,

danke für die Infos, hier der Auszug:

get hm configCheck

configCheck done:

missing register list
    HM_44980C: RegL_00.,RegL_01.

peer list incomplete. Use getConfig to read it.
    incomplete: HM_44980C:

PairedTo missing/unknown
    HM_44980C

PairedTo mismatch to IODev
    HM_45917C paired:0xF11034 IO attr: -.
    HM_462D99 paired:0xF11034 IO attr: -.
    Rollo.Arbeitszimmer paired:0xF11034 IO attr: -.




get hm peerCheck


peerCheck done:

peer list incomplete. Use getConfig to read it.
    incomplete: HM_44980C:


set HM_44980C getConfig gibt keine Aussage.

Danke.

Gruß
Marco



Otto123

Da ist etwas mit der Konfiguration faul: Ich weiß nicht mehr genau was -> PairedTo mismatch to IODev

gab es aber hier im Forum schon öfter.

Egal, versuche den HM_44980C zu pairen und erstmal nichts anderes! Das muss in Ordnung sein, vorher geht es nicht weiter.

Gruß Otto
Viele Grüße aus Leipzig  ⇉  nächster Stammtisch an der Lindennaundorfer Mühle
RaspberryPi B B+ B2 B3 B3+ ZeroW,HMLAN,HMUART,Homematic,Fritz!Box 7590,WRT3200ACS-OpenWrt,Sonos,VU+,Arduino nano,ESP8266,MQTT,Zigbee,deconz

frank

FHEM: 6.0(SVN) => Pi3(buster)
IO: CUL433|CUL868|HMLAN|HMUSB2|HMUART
CUL_HM: CC-TC|CC-VD|SEC-SD|SEC-SC|SEC-RHS|Sw1PBU-FM|Sw1-FM|Dim1TPBU-FM|Dim1T-FM|ES-PMSw1-Pl
IT: ITZ500|ITT1500|ITR1500|GRR3500
WebUI [HMdeviceTools.js (hm.js)]: https://forum.fhem.de/index.php/topic,106959.0.html